How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Etna?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Etna Studio Apartments | $2,259 | $925 | $9,551 |
| Etna 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,198 | $795 | $5,223 |
| Etna 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,347 | $1,025 | $8,694 |
| Etna 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,039 | $1,150 | $3,036 |
| Etna 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,825 | $2,150 | $3,500 |
